English-Tagalog Dictionary

Rate this book
Fr. English's English-Tagalog Dictionary is so far the most adequate, the most scholarly, and the most complete English-Tagalog dictionary ever published. (From the Introduction by Jose Villa Panganiban)

The main English entries number more than 14,000 but in addition to these there are about 40,000 nuances which have also been translated. Moreover, there are approximately 30,000 English sentences with their Tagalog translations to illustrate the use of the main words and their nuances. The grand total of entries is approximately 80,000. (From the Preface.)

1211 pages, Paperback

First published January 1, 1977
